    A music video for King Kobra's "Iron Eagle (Never Say Die)" was made to promote the film. The video features Louis Gossett Jr. reprising his role as Col. "Chappy" Sinclair, who has the band cut their hair and undergo boot camp training for them to prove themselves as pilots.

    Sweda recorded two records with King Kobra (Ready to Strike and Thrill of a Lifetime) and toured extensively, opening for bands such as Iron Maiden, Kiss and Ted Nugent. [1] Sweda left the band in 1987 and started BulletBoys [1] with Marq Torien, who had briefly served as King Kobra's lead singer. [2] The band signed to Warner Bros. Records in ...
